首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[教程]Vue3与TypeScript:解锁高效开发新篇章,探索跨语言融合的无限可能

发布于 2025-07-06 12:14:26
0
597

Vue3和TypeScript的结合,为现代Web开发带来了革命性的变化。本文将深入探讨Vue3与TypeScript的融合,分析其优势、应用场景以及如何在实际项目中高效利用这两种技术。Vue3简介V...

Vue3和TypeScript的结合,为现代Web开发带来了革命性的变化。本文将深入探讨Vue3与TypeScript的融合,分析其优势、应用场景以及如何在实际项目中高效利用这两种技术。

Vue3简介

Vue3是Vue.js框架的下一代主要版本,它引入了许多新的特性和改进,旨在提升性能和开发体验。以下是Vue3的一些核心特性:

  • Composition API:提供了一种更灵活的方式来组织组件逻辑。
  • 性能优化:通过Tree-shaking和Proxies等技术,Vue3在性能上有了显著提升。
  • 构建优化:基于Vite等现代构建工具,Vue3的构建速度更快。

TypeScript简介

TypeScript是一种由微软开发的开源编程语言,它扩展了JavaScript,增加了类型系统。TypeScript的主要优势包括:

  • 易于维护:在大型项目中,TypeScript有助于团队协作和代码审查。
  • 提高代码质量:通过严格的类型检查,TypeScript确保了代码的一致性。

Vue3与TypeScript的兼容性

Vue3与TypeScript的兼容性非常高,以下是一些关键点:

  • 官方支持:Vue3提供了官方的TypeScript支持,包括类型定义文件和类型注解。
  • 代码自动补全:大多数现代IDE都支持Vue3和TypeScript的自动补全和代码导航功能。

Vue3与TypeScript协同工作的优势

  • 提升开发效率:TypeScript的静态类型检查可以帮助开发者快速发现潜在的错误,从而减少调试时间。
  • 增强代码质量:通过严格的类型检查,TypeScript确保了代码的一致性。

应用场景

Vue3与TypeScript的结合适用于以下场景:

  • 大型项目:TypeScript的类型系统有助于减少运行时错误,提高代码质量。
  • 多人协作:TypeScript提供代码提示、类型检查等功能,提高开发效率。
  • 跨平台开发:TypeScript支持编译成JavaScript,方便跨平台部署。

实际项目中的应用

以下是一个简单的Vue3和TypeScript项目示例:

<template> <div> <h1>{{ title }}</h1> </div>
</template>
<script lang="ts">
import { defineComponent, ref } from 'vue';
export default defineComponent({ name: 'HelloWorld', setup() { const title = ref('Vue3 + TypeScript'); return { title }; },
});
</script>

在这个例子中,我们使用了Vue3的Composition API和TypeScript的类型系统来创建一个简单的组件。

总结

Vue3与TypeScript的结合为现代Web开发带来了新的可能性。通过利用这两种技术的优势,开发者可以构建更加高效、健壮和可维护的应用程序。随着前端技术的不断发展,Vue3和TypeScript的结合将会成为未来Web开发的主流趋势。

评论
一个月内的热帖推荐
csdn大佬
Lv.1普通用户

452398

帖子

22

小组

841

积分

赞助商广告
站长交流